Output 8d963106e7cbbdc9672e52619ba267a29586a7bf06a1a8c6ab27e5b64af93eb9:2

value
170730
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 65758bc7c02a910b6aafa9dc0266149f08eab4eafb4fdbf409bf71ad6281df1f
address
tb1pv46ch37q92gsk64048wqyes5nuyw4d82ld8ahaqfhac66c5pmu0slx9en0
transaction
8d963106e7cbbdc9672e52619ba267a29586a7bf06a1a8c6ab27e5b64af93eb9
confirmations
51539
spent
true